This shepherd’s hut-style cabin in Cornwall is not far from the lovely town of St Austell, the sailing opportunities at Fowey, and the beach at Par. But the place it’s closest to of all is the place you must visit while you’re here: The Eden Project. Tucked away in its own enclosed garden, The Cabin is just two miles away from Cornwall’s most popular tourist attraction. It offers a cute, cosy, and convenient place to stay in central southern Cornwall – and it’s dog friendly too.
The cabin is a solo hire site; you’ll be the only glampers here and won’t have to share the fenced, enclosed garden with anyone. But that doesn’t mean you’ll be in the middle of nowhere either. The cabin is in the heart of St Blazey, tucked between houses and the railway line that serves Par. It’s an easy location to get to – even if you’re arriving on public transport as Par Station is less than a mile from here. You can walk to a pub and a shop easily. It’s just a little further to the beach at Par Sands and even the Eden Project is reachable on foot if you don’t mind a couple of miles of ups and downs. If you have a car, there’s plenty more to explore: Polkerris, Fowey, The Lost Gardens of Heligan, Mevagissey… the list goes on and on.
Back at base in St Blazey, you have everything you need to rest in between your days out. In some ways the cabin has a classic shepherd’s hut feel with a curved and clad roof over a double bed, a kitchenette with a butler sink and a log burner. But it’s also modern too. It has electricity and running water to power an electric kettle, microwave and smart TV. There’s WiFi too. And the flushing toilet and hot-water shower are en suite so it’s not too rustic here. Outside, there’s an electric grill and a fire pit with outdoor seating and a hammock slung between trees so you can kick back and relax while dinner’s cooking. But, if you don’t fancy it, don’t cook. After all, in this handy location, there are pubs and takeaways just up the road.
